Common Causes of your Concrete Problems in Chapel Hill

Noticed uneven floors in your home? In and around Chapel Hill, environmental patterns can affect how soil interacts with your foundation, causing these issues. One common factor is the area's clay-rich soil, which swells and shrinks with moisture changes. Some neighborhoods experience poor drainage and seasonal moisture swings, contributing to soil movement beneath homes. With these conditions, the soil can expand during wet seasons and contract in dry periods, resulting in shifting that impacts your foundation over time.

When the ground beneath your home moves, it can lead to foundation settling, which often manifests as uneven floors or stuck doors in many homes locally. Other warning signs include wall cracks and water pooling in basements or crawl spaces. Addressing these issues early is crucial, as soil movement can progressively lead to significant structural problems if left unchecked. Concrete lifting is a solution that can effectively stabilize your foundation by filling voids created by the shifting soil, thereby preventing further damage and maintaining a stable and secure home environment.
